Receiving at the new Saltforth Wharf site should expect eleven crates on Thursday: archive files, the two plotter units, and the sealed finance cabinet. Each crate carries a numbered manifest sticker; check these against the master list before signing, and flag any broken seals immediately rather than accepting with notes. The finance cabinet must go directly to the third-floor strongroom, unopened, and remain logged as in-transit until audit confirms contents. Give the courier the following instruction at hand-over.

dispatch memo: the eliok quenok courier leaves the sorael aldath belion tammir casix gileth queniel jorath ledger at gate 9299 under passcode 897989

## 3.2.0 — Changed defaults

Consentgate banner rollout moved from opt-in to default-on for all Bramblehurst-hosted tenants. Banner dismissal TTL shortened; re-prompt logic now fires on policy version bumps, not calendar intervals. If you get paged for elevated 4xx on the preferences endpoint, it's almost certainly a tenant still pinning the old schema — roll them forward, don't revert the defaults. The new default configuration shipped with this release is as follows.

settings of fafog-haduf:
ZORIX_PIN=4648
ZORIX_METRICS_HOST=metrics.zorix.paliqsys.corp
ZORIX_LOG_LEVEL=info
ZORIX_TENANT=druix

Subject: Your first shift — the cron drift saga

Hey, welcome to on-call! One thing to have on your radar: jobs on the Marlowe scheduler have been drifting, some firing up to three minutes late, and downstream reports keep paging us about stale data. It's annoying but not dangerous — acknowledge, note the drift amount, and move on unless it exceeds five minutes. Everything we've learned so far, plus the mitigation checklist, lives on the internal investigation page.

wiki page, tahaf-tajog: https://jira.ordindyn.corp/pipeline